The Farelab ticket-pricing experiment service rejected last night's config push with a signature mismatch, so the new fare variants never went live and all venues fell back to baseline pricing. Root cause: the config was signed with the retired staging key after last week's rotation. No customer-facing pricing errors occurred. Support should tell experimenters to re-sign configs with the current key and resubmit; pushes verified against it deploy normally. The active verification key is below.

release key, bahof-hafog: bky3_ztf

Subject: Renewal of Corporate Insurance Programme — Detailed Summary

Dear colleagues,

Our combined policy with Arbenfield Assurance is due for renewal on 30 April. The proposed premium reflects a 7.4% increase, driven chiefly by revised flood-risk ratings at the Colmere warehouse. Cover limits remain unchanged; the deductible on marine cargo rises slightly. Finance should accrue the difference from Q2 onward and confirm the payment schedule with treasury.

A full broker comparison is attached for review.

The note below explains the timing.

board note of yagap-fahop: The northern region missed its Julix quota by 6.7 percent last quarter. Goroxix Partners plans to raise the Caswyn list price by 6.7 percent in April. The board signed off on a budget of $201.2 million for Project Gilath. The renewal with Zoriusax Group closes at $431.5 million a year, 51.5 percent below the last contract.

Ticket: Config drift on Bramblewick DB pool

Staging and prod pools for the Orlo service have diverged again. Prod was hand-edited during the June incident and never reconciled, so timeout and max-connection values no longer match the repo. Risk: next release will silently revert the incident tuning. Requesting a drift freeze before cut. Current prod values, captured today, are listed below.

settings of fafog-haduf:
ZORIX_PIN=4648
ZORIX_METRICS_HOST=metrics.zorix.paliqsys.corp
ZORIX_LOG_LEVEL=info
ZORIX_TENANT=druix